1. Better circulation and warmth
As we age, blood circulation slows, and the skin on our feet becomes thinner and more susceptible to injury. As a result, we lose body heat more quickly. Cold feet and poor circulation can worsen existing conditions like diabetes, arthritis, or chronic swelling. Wearing soft, breathable socks made from natural fibers like cotton, wool, and bamboo helps retain gentle warmth without overheating, allowing blood vessels to maintain open flow and free circulation.
Better circulation affects not only the comfort of your feet, but also the entire cardiovascular system.
